Currently most code to get child count in kernel are almost same,
add a helper to implement this function for dt to use.

diff --git a/include/linux/of.h b/include/linux/of.h
index 4948552..d0d91a1 100644
--- a/include/linux/of.h
+++ b/include/linux/of.h
@@ -189,6 +189,17 @@ extern struct device_node *of_get_next_child(const struct 
device_node *node,
        for (child = of_get_next_child(parent, NULL); child != NULL; \
             child = of_get_next_child(parent, child))
 
+static inline int of_get_child_count(const struct device_node *np)
+{
+       struct device_node *child = NULL;
+       int num = 0;
+
+       while ((child = of_get_next_child(np, child)))
+               num++;
+
+       return num;
+}
+
 extern struct device_node *of_find_node_with_property(
        struct device_node *from, const char *prop_name);
 #define for_each_node_with_property(dn, prop_name) \
@@ -262,6 +273,11 @@ static inline bool of_have_populated_dt(void)
 #define for_each_child_of_node(parent, child) \
        while (0)
 
+static inline int of_get_child_count(const struct device_node *np)
+{
+       return -ENOSYS;
+}
+
 static inline int of_device_is_compatible(const struct device_node *device,
                                          const char *name)
 {
